Transaction 21293c3475e6153e15ecb6417770cb064d04831a60c428b2f9cfa492fef85992

1 Input
2 Outputs
  • 21293c3475e6153e15ecb6417770cb064d04831a60c428b2f9cfa492fef85992:0
  • value  1375219
    address  37H8oVZf9jcSXfz3JYfaBh9CWA5xBLDvyq
  • 21293c3475e6153e15ecb6417770cb064d04831a60c428b2f9cfa492fef85992:1
  • value  13244515
    address  3LqRFhXgV92fKTBNvY761fFz9Lp2gzBsDY